c语言求源程序

来源:百度知道 编辑:UC知道 时间:2024/05/17 16:11:51
要求:
用指向指针的指针完成对n个整数的排序并输出。
排序由一个单独的函数完成。n个数的输入和输出由主函数来完成。
大哥,我又不是不舍得给分。
如果一开始就放分了,到后面又没有自己想要的答案,分就没有了,好不好。
如果分对于你很重要的话,你好好答题,答好的话,我再补分给你。

大哥,这个好像没有实现排序的功能啊。

兄弟!我...
我不是很看重分,呵呵,能交几个志同道合的朋友最好了。。
还没把它分成函数,你自己去分。。
这个a就是相当于一个偏移地址。。
开始看到这个题目还真像楼上的兄弟说的“不会做”呵呵,,技术有限,不符合你的要求。
我再改改
int a;
main()
{int **p,*q=&a;
int i,j,n;
p=&q;
printf("please input a numb:n");
scanf("%d",&n);
for(i=1;i<n;i++)scanf("%d",q+i);/*输入部分*/
for(i=1;i<n;i++) /* 排序部分*/
{a=*q+i;
for(j=i+1;j<n;j++)
if(a>*(q+j))
{a=*(q+j);
*(q+j)=*(q+i);
*(q+i)=a;
}
}
for(i=1;i<n;i++)/*输出部分*/
printf("%d,",*(q+i));

}

大家是来交流的可好哎 积分有那么重要啊 还是你不会做